一、系统资源占用分析与优化
服务器资源不足是导致宝塔面板卡顿的常见原因,建议通过以下步骤排查:
- 使用
top
命令检查CPU和内存使用率,若超过80%需考虑升级配置或优化进程 - 通过
iostat -x 1
监控磁盘I/O,清理日志文件或迁移大体积数据降低负载 - 使用
free -m
查看Swap使用,建议设置Swap空间为物理内存的1.5-2倍
优化项 | 实施方法 | 效果预估 |
---|---|---|
内存释放 | 设置定时任务清理缓存 | 提升15%-30%响应速度 |
PHP并发调整 | 修改pm.max_children参数 | 降低30%进程切换开销 |
二、数据库性能瓶颈排查方法
数据库效率直接影响面板操作体验,建议执行以下优化步骤:
- 启用慢查询日志定位耗时SQL语句,使用EXPLAIN分析执行计划
- 定期执行
OPTIMIZE TABLE
命令修复碎片化数据表 - 为高频查询字段添加复合索引,避免全表扫描
建议安装Redis缓存插件,将查询响应时间缩短40%-60%
三、面板设置与运行环境调优
针对面板本身的优化可显著提升操作流畅度:
- 升级至最新版本面板,修复已知性能缺陷
- 禁用非必要插件,减少后台进程资源占用
- 调整日志级别为warning,降低磁盘写入频率
安装「堡塔面板静态文件加速」插件可改善远程访问延迟问题
通过系统资源监控、数据库索引优化与面板配置调整的三维排查方案,可有效解决90%以上的卡顿问题。建议每月执行资源使用审计,并建立自动化运维任务维持服务器最佳状态。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/439288.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。